That latter component is the most interesting aspect of the play: Jordan is well aware that he and his neuroses long have functioned as gay comic relief for his gal pals, all of whom are willing to dump him when their lives turn serious. It has since become the third most-produced play in the United States this season and transferred to Londons West End after sell-out runs at Theatre Royal Bath and the St. James Theatre. Joshua Harmons Significant Other," now in its first Chicago production at Theater Wit under the lively direction of Keira Fromm, is a black comedy about a painful transition that hits many of us urbanites in our late 20s or early 30s and goes a long way toward explaining why weddings can be such fraught affairs for anyone stuck in a tux or matching crinoline.
